| Name | TWO_PI (6.28318...) |
||
|---|---|---|---|
| Examples | ![]() float f = 0.0;
beginShape(POLYGON);
while(f < TWO_PI) {
vertex(width/2 + cos(f)*40, height/2 + sin(f)*40);
f += PI/12.0;
}
endShape(); |
||
| Description | TWO_PI is a mathematical constant with the value 6.28318530717958647693. It is twice the ratio of the circumference of a circle to its diameter. It is useful in combination with the trigonometric functions sin() and cos(). | ||
